Job summary

The Center for Global Development (CGD) in Washington, DC seeks a thoughtful, productive DEI and Recruitment Associate to drive our DEI initiatives and recruitment strategy. You will co-chair the DEI Committee, lead planning for CGD's Summer Delegates internship program, and partner with hiring teams to create a fair, efficient hiring process across the organization.

You will design and implement outreach to universities, expand partnerships, and help refine processes for greater equity.

Qualifications

  • Strong interest in DEI topics and current issues.
  • Mid-career level experience in managing recruitment processes and policies.
  • High emotional intelligence, empathy and humility.
  • Familiarity with internship programs, university outreach, and campus recruitment.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ication, organizational skills.
  • Ability to take initiative and carry projects with minimal supervision.
  • Collaborative mindset to build internal partnerships and drive DEI work.
  • Motivation to stay productive and see tasks through to completion.
  • Experience with ATS tools (JazzHR or similar).
  • SharePoint experience is a plus.

Responsibilities

  • Plan and manage CGD's Summer Delegates Program with a robust schedule.
  • Co-chair the DEI Committee and lead discussions and resource sharing.
  • Draft/edit job descriptions and manage posting, screening, and interview coordination.
  • Partner with hiring teams to support organization-wide recruitment efforts.
  • Participate in operations team meetings across People, IT, Administration, and Finance.
  • Advocate for DEI, build internal partnerships, and drive equitable outcomes.
  • Identify trends and align projects with CGD's DEI goals.
  • Prepare DEI-related data for reporting and work with Communications to publish it.
  • Support university partnerships and expand CGD's network.
